The product of two consecutive positive integers is 132. What are the integers?

Mathematics
1 answer:
alina1380 [7]3 years ago
5 0

Answer:

The integers are 11 and 12

Step-by-step explanation:

11 and 12 are consecutive positive integers, and 11 x 12 = 132.
